Who is Jaime Jarrín?
Jaime Jarrín is the Spanish language voice of the Los Angeles Dodgers. He began broadcasting for the Dodgers in 1958, and was the 1998 recipient of the Ford C. Frick Award from the Baseball Hall of Fame. One of the most recognizable voices in Hispanic broadcasting, Jarrin, "the Spanish Voice of the Dodgers" is also heard on FSN Prime Ticket's SAP channel.
